anjet 发表于 2014-3-18 15:55

yuweihan 发表于 2014-3-17 17:36 static/image/common/back.gif
新玩法,没玩过

是的,想得越深入遇见的问题越来越多了。。。

anjet 发表于 2014-3-18 15:59

最近完成的东西,做了个uv表的控件,能正常使用了
但是比较麻烦的是,指针乱跳,速度太快了,指针没有真实表头的那种惯性的感觉,瞬间觉得很山寨,需要完成的细节越来越多了。。。。。。
这是运行时候的相片:



这是运行界面的无码高清大图

anjet 发表于 2014-3-21 18:16

本帖最后由 anjet 于 2014-3-21 18:26 编辑

今天把两个播放时候的显示界面也完成了,是从手机的mic取到播放的数据,然后用uv表显示出来,或者用fft以频谱的方式显示出来。
因为是电脑耳塞播放,给废旧手机的mic输入的,所以效果会差一点,视频中显示了 uv表的显示,和用扫频的音频输入到手机之中显示的fft结果,因为是麦克风读取的,所以有环境的噪音。
这几天天天上班偷偷弄,回家带娃娃。。。要抽个时间整合起来,就开始做前级板子啦。
目前还未解决的问题:
手机启动时间的问题
手机管理前级电池和休眠的问题
手机怎么嵌入到前级面板里才好看的问题
这个智能前级要不要支持红外遥控的发送和接受,以自动控制电视,cd等。
下面就是演示的视频了
有需要软件源代码的请悄悄话。。。反正我这个500M Hz   CPU的里程碑跑起来是没有问题的。
http://v.youku.com/v_show/id_XNjg4Mjg0Mzg0.html

再上个无码高清大图


群兴电器11 发表于 2014-3-21 19:06

weilin6689228 发表于 2014-3-22 02:34

学习了

anjet 发表于 2014-4-4 12:44

群兴电器11 发表于 2014-3-21 19:06 static/image/common/back.gif
有想法

这两天没有时间搞,直到昨天又找了几个手机玩了一下
不同版本的手机上还有有些小问题。

anjet 发表于 2014-4-4 12:45

weilin6689228 发表于 2014-3-22 02:34 static/image/common/back.gif
学习了

:handshake

都是瞎玩

hifilw 发表于 2014-4-5 11:30


这东西有用:)

anjet 发表于 2014-4-7 20:02

hifilw 发表于 2014-4-5 11:30 static/image/common/back.gif
这东西有用

:handshake
谢谢,也可能会很不实用;P

anjet 发表于 2014-4-7 22:40

今天抽空玩了会,搭了一个信号检测的电路,当输入端口有信号的时候,就唤醒前级开始工作,目前觉得整个系统的电源和休眠管理还没有规划好,需要仔细想一想,因为开机时间的原因,初步决定长时间使用的时候也不关机,由嵌入前级的手机自己管理电池和充电,没有任务的时候进入休眠,有输入信号的时候,唤醒机器开始工作
这是模拟的电路


搭的电路



在关掉ipod之后,信号消失,程序也检测到了,看图里面true 变成了false,时间有限,只是检测查出来,还没有写业务逻辑

侃单 发表于 2014-4-8 12:48

关注一下!!!

anjet 发表于 2014-4-16 13:48

本帖最后由 anjet 于 2014-4-16 15:06 编辑

一个草草结束的结局,天有不测风云,我的“淘汰手机”终于挂掉了
把目前完成的工作放上来吧,有兴趣的兄弟们可以把源代码下去用
我也把生产的手机安装文件放上来,有用的兄弟们可以拿去用。
http://pan.baidu.com/s/1qWFaFda
接线方式如下:定义了5个输入,2个输出口,通过usb连接前面板上的显示手机。


这是运行界面的截图:
















场景是可修改,,每个场景的音量是独立的,可记忆的,场景可以删除和配置,但是还没有做配置界面。。。
直接用代码生成的
      arg0.execSQL("deletefrom "+TABLE_NAME);



              arg0.execSQL("INSERT INTO "+TABLE_NAME+
                            " (name, vol,outputPort,inputPort,imageId,viewId)"+
                "VALUES ('CD', 1,1,1,0,1)" );
              arg0.execSQL("INSERT INTO "+TABLE_NAME+
                               " (name, vol,outputPort,inputPort,imageId,viewId)"+
                "VALUES ('DAC', 1,2,2,1,2)" );
              arg0.execSQL("INSERT INTO "+TABLE_NAME+
                               " (name, vol,outputPort,inputPort,imageId,viewId)"+
                "VALUES ('电脑', 1,2,3,2,2)" );
              arg0.execSQL("INSERT INTO "+TABLE_NAME+
                               " (name, vol,outputPort,inputPort,imageId,viewId)"+
                "VALUES ('蓝牙', 1,2,4,3,1)" );
              arg0.execSQL("INSERT INTO "+TABLE_NAME+
                            " (name, vol,outputPort,inputPort,imageId,viewId)"+
          "VALUES ('本机播放', 1,2,4,4,1)" );
              arg0.execSQL("INSERT INTO "+TABLE_NAME+
                            " (name, vol,outputPort,inputPort,imageId,viewId)"+
             "VALUES ('专家模式', 1,2,4,5,3)" );
              。
有兴趣的兄弟直接改就可以了,这是运行的视频:
http://v.youku.com/v_show/id_XNjk5NTAyNTY4.html


不算总结的总结:
思维还是僵化了,想的很多功能不实用,做减法全删得差不多了,受制于手机+ioio的架构,电源管理,能源管理不方便做,有信号唤醒也实现不了了,很难实现由复杂到简单的过程,还是沦落成了一个显示频谱和调节音量的东西。
这不是一个结束。。。。。。。



风度溜溜 发表于 2014-4-24 10:21

又一个吃“螃蟹”的高人出现了

不锈钢胆 发表于 2014-5-1 21:02

支持一下

kailekk 发表于 2014-5-1 21:51

我也想知道

kailekk 发表于 2014-5-1 21:52

什么样子的都可以吗 只要是安卓

kailekk 发表于 2014-5-1 21:56

还是没有看懂,可否详细些,小白

anjet 发表于 2014-5-1 23:35

风度溜溜 发表于 2014-4-24 10:21 static/image/common/back.gif
又一个吃“螃蟹”的高人出现了

:lol,电源管理和启动时间很不人性化,在想办法ing。

anjet 发表于 2014-5-1 23:37

不锈钢胆 发表于 2014-5-1 21:02 static/image/common/back.gif
支持一下

:handshake谢谢支持

anjet 发表于 2014-5-1 23:39

kailekk 发表于 2014-5-1 21:56 static/image/common/back.gif
还是没有看懂,可否详细些,小白

就是用淘汰的安卓手机来装进前级里面,做前级的控制和显示部分。
这样的话,基于android,界面就容易做的很漂亮,也支持触摸,wifi   蓝牙等硬件都包含进去了,可以有很多玩法。
页: 1 2 [3] 4
查看完整版本: 利用淘汰安卓手机制作输入选择和音量控制等功能。